About WENA

The West End Neighborhood Association addresses issues and concerns that affect the quality of life of all who live and/or work in the West End of Portland, Maine. We provide programs, serve as a liaison to City Hall, monitor city services, provide development news, and ensure that our neighborhood is clean, safe, quiet, and attractive.
